## Signing Notes — Quota Service

Hey reviewer — the per-tenant rate quota module in Brightmoor now ships as a signed artifact. If the diff touches quota math, make sure the build is re-signed before merge, or staging will reject it. For reference, builds are verified against the key below.

signing key of yajef-yawip = bky13_B1KcmdaWRA7cw

## Onboarding: Gateway Rate Limiting

The Cresswell gateway enforces a token-bucket limit per caller identity: 200 requests/min by default, configurable per route in `limits.yaml`. Exceeding the bucket returns 429 with a retry hint. Identities are derived from signed caller assertions, never IPs alone. Verifying those assertions requires the shared secret defined on the next line.

sealed setting: COURIER_KEY29=58d9ea6bce2b68ce7faee67385abf

Quarterly Planning Note — Gross-Margin Review

For the finance team: the review of Norvale product-line margins is complete. Blended gross margin improved 1.8 points, driven chiefly by renegotiated freight on the Ashfell route and reduced rework on the Talis range. Detailed workings are filed separately. The confidential note on forward plans follows immediately below.

board note of fafog-yahap: Project Rusdor slips by a full year because of the audit delay.

# Approvals — Websocket Reconnect Fix

Bug: Driftline clients dropped sessions after idle reconnect; backoff timer never reset. Fix: patch to the reconnect state machine plus a jitter cap. Status: merged, behind flag.

Approvals needed before flag removal: load test at 50k concurrent reconnects, mobile client soak (48h), and on-call sign-off. First two are done; soak results land Thursday. Rollback is a single flag flip, no data migration. Raise blockers at the sync. Final approval and flag removal sit with the engineer named below.

named custodian: Brivan Eliath Quenox Frador